Комплексное руководство: добавление среды Conda в Jupyter Notebook

Jupyter Notebook — популярная интерактивная веб-среда разработки, широко используемая в науке о данных, программировании и других областях. Conda, с другой стороны, представляет собой систему управления пакетами и систему управления средой для установки и управления пакетами программного обеспечения. В этой статье мы рассмотрим различные способы добавления среды Conda в Jupyter Notebook, что позволит вам легко переключаться между различными средами Python для ваших проектов.

Метод 1. Установка Jupyter в среде Conda

  1. Создайте новую среду Conda: откройте терминал или командную строку Anaconda и выполните следующую команду:

    conda create -n myenv python=3.8

    При этом создается новая среда Conda с именем «myenv» с Python 3.8.

  2. Активируйте среду: выполните следующую команду, чтобы активировать вновь созданную среду:

    conda activate myenv
  3. Установите Jupyter Notebook: при активированной среде установите Jupyter Notebook с помощью следующей команды:

    conda install jupyter
  4. Запустите Jupyter Notebook: запустите Jupyter Notebook, выполнив команду:

    jupyter notebook

    Откроется Jupyter в веб-браузере по умолчанию.

Метод 2. Использование среды Conda в качестве ядра в Jupyter

  1. Создайте новую среду Conda (если она еще не создана) с помощью команды, упомянутой в методе 1.

  2. Активировать среду.

  3. Установить ipykernel: выполните следующую команду, чтобы установить пакет ipykernel, который позволяет нам использовать среды Conda в качестве ядер в Jupyter:

    conda install ipykernel
  4. Добавьте среду в качестве ядра: выполните следующую команду, чтобы добавить среду Conda в качестве ядра в Jupyter:

    python -m ipykernel install --user --name=myenv

    Замените «myenv» на имя вашей среды Conda.

  5. Запустите Jupyter Notebook: запустите Jupyter Notebook с помощью команды jupyter notebook, и вы увидите вновь добавленное ядро ​​в раскрывающемся списке ядер.

Метод 3. Использование Anaconda Navigator

  1. Откройте Anaconda Navigator, графический пользовательский интерфейс для управления средами Conda.

  2. Создайте новую среду или выберите существующую на вкладке «Среды».

  3. Нажмите на вкладку «Главная» и запустите Jupyter Notebook оттуда. Он будет автоматически использовать выбранную среду.

В этой статье мы рассмотрели три различных метода добавления среды Conda в Jupyter Notebook. Следуя этим методам, вы можете создавать и использовать отдельные среды Conda для разных проектов, обеспечивая изоляцию и гибкость. Независимо от того, предпочитаете ли вы использовать командную строку или графический интерфейс, теперь у вас есть знания, позволяющие легко интегрировать среды Conda с Jupyter Notebook, повышая вашу производительность и организацию проекта.

Не забудьте активировать нужную среду перед запуском Jupyter Notebook, чтобы убедиться, что используется правильная среда. Наслаждайтесь программированием в Jupyter, используя возможности Conda!